    About Temitope

    Temitope, a name steeped in the rich Yoruba culture, carries a beautiful sentiment of gratitude and thankfulness. This unisex choice immediately suggests a family that cherishes blessings and approaches life with a joyful heart, reflecting its direct meaning "Mine is worthy of thanks." While many names convey joy, Temitope uniquely frames it as a personal possession, a recognition of one's own inherent worth and the good fortune in their life. It's a name that feels both grounded and uplifting, perfect for parents seeking a meaningful connection to West African heritage or simply a name that speaks volumes about appreciation and a positive outlook.
